bycj.net
当前位置:首页 >> js封装json数组 >>

js封装json数组

如果想对json数组进行操作向其中添加元素,将其转化为数组对象。 JavaScript一种直译式脚本语言,是一种动态类型、弱类型、基于原型的语言,内置支持类型。它的解释器被称为JavaScript引擎,为浏览器的一部分,广泛用于客户端的脚本语言,最早是...

var data1 = "[{ value: '3017', label: '3017:有机磷农药,液体的,有毒的,易燃的'},{ value: '3018', label: '3018:有机磷农药,液体的,有毒的'}]";json1 = eval("(" + data1 + ")");alert(json1[0].label);alert(json1[1].label);

字符串格式json转化成json对象有3种方式: 1:js下用eval生成JSON对象 ---通过eval() 函数可以将JSON字符串转化为对象。 2:使用函数方式 3:使用js的json库或者jQuery提供的js库 --- 如果基于安全的考虑的话,最好是使用一个 JSON 解析器。 一...

json={sensorId:sensorId:_store.getAt(i).get('sensorId'),sensorType:sensorType:_store.getAt(i).get('sensorType'),signalCode:signalCode:_store.getAt(i).get('signalCode')};

用下面的函数: eval ("(" + JSON格式的字符串 + ")"); 或者用dojo var jsnObj = dojo.fromJson(JSON格式的字符串);

你说的是使用函数转化吗?代码如下: var data=[]; data[0]="username"; data[1] = "password"; data[2] = "repassword"; alert(data); data = $.toJSON(data); //将数组转换成json格式 alert(data); data = $.parseJSON(data); //将json格式转...

//body部分//JS部分$("#floor0,#floor1,#floor2").combobox({ url : "/app/getInfo?userId=" + userId, method : "get", valueField : 'ID', textField : 'Name'});

普通的数组格式是:['a','b','c'] JSON的格式是:{'1':'a','2':'b','3':'c'} 所以把数组循环一下就可以了; var a = ['a','b','c'];var json = {};for(var i=0;i

var array = []; var json={"time":"1122","a":"123","b":"234"} , {"time":"1133","a":"456","b":"567"}; for(var i=0; i < json.length; i++){ var arrayTemp = []; arrayTemp .push(json[i].time); arrayTemp .push(json[i].a); arrayTemp .p...

1、页面引用jquery库; 2、调用jquery的ajax方法,获取数据 url:请求的url路径; $.ajax({ url: url, dataType: 'json', //请求发送前处理 beforeSend: function () { // }, //请求发生错误的处理 error: function (XMLHttpRequest, textStatus,...

网站首页 | 网站地图
All rights reserved Powered by www.bycj.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com